通用算力型和密集计算型的区别?

通用算力型与密集计算型:一场计算架构的较量

在当今数字化的世界中,计算机的性能和架构对于各个行业的发展至关重要。两种主要的计算类型——通用算力型和密集计算型,各自扮演着独特的角色,它们的区别不仅在于技术层面,更深层次上影响着企业的决策、效率以及创新速度。这里将首先阐述两者的区别,然后深入探讨其背后的原理和应用场景。

首先,让我们明确结论:通用算力型计算着重于提供广泛而均衡的能力,适用于日常的多任务处理和基础计算需求;而密集计算型则聚焦于特定领域的高度优化,以实现极致性能和效率,适用于深度学习、科学计算等专业领域。

通用算力型,顾名思义,它的设计目标是满足各种类型的计算任务,无论是简单的数据处理还是复杂的图形渲染。这类计算机通常采用多核心处理器,内存大,I/O速度快,能够应对日常办公、网页浏览、轻度游戏等广泛的使用场景。由于其灵活性和普适性,通用算力型被广泛应用于个人电脑、服务器和云计算平台。

相比之下,密集计算型则是在特定领域进行了深度优化。这种计算架构往往配备高性能的GPU(图形处理器)或TPU(张量处理器),专为并行计算和大量数据处理设计。例如,在机器学习和人工智能领域,密集计算型设备能快速训练模型,进行大规模的数据挖掘和分析。在科学研究中,它能处理复杂的模拟和计算问题。然而,密集计算型的灵活性较差,对特定任务的高度依赖使得它在其他非专业领域可能表现不佳。

接下来,我们进一步分析这两种计算架构的优缺点。通用算力型的优点在于易用性和广泛性,但其性能可能因任务变化而波动,且对于一些特定任务的优化不足。密集计算型虽然在特定领域表现出色,但初始投资高,维护成本也可能增加,而且对于不熟悉的专业知识要求较高。

在实际应用中,企业需要根据自身的业务需求来选择合适的计算类型。对于那些需要处理多样化任务、用户基础广泛的公司,通用算力型可能是更好的选择。而对于那些追求极致性能、专注于某一特定领域的企业,密集计算型则能提供关键的竞争优势。

总结来说,通用算力型和密集计算型是两种截然不同的计算策略,它们在性能、灵活性和适用范围上存在显著差异。理解并选择适合自己的计算架构,对于提升工作效率、推动技术创新具有至关重要的作用。在未来的数字化进程中,如何平衡通用与专业,将是企业和科技发展的重要课题。

未经允许不得转载:秒懂云 » 通用算力型和密集计算型的区别?